Output 67a98a5c05714f0a5a8fb6b5a09c9f56af899de21ffae3249e81f4a4051ff59c:1

value
64479517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99aa8a96479730e2c34e9eeeb6aa6354fee81de5 OP_EQUAL
address
MMufvCddvC7GAGFX7Pdb7VyPAEkXXPDLWz
transaction
67a98a5c05714f0a5a8fb6b5a09c9f56af899de21ffae3249e81f4a4051ff59c
spent
true